SoeAtlas.org - India’s Online State Of The Environmental Atlas

To mark Earth Day, the Environment Ministry has launched the first digital State of the Environmental atlas of India at Soeatlas.Org which provides a visual interactive interface for users to visualise environment spatial data using geographic information system (GIS) options. The atlas depicts forest and biodiversity in green, water resources in blue and air pollution in brown colours. As the site claims, the purpose of the atlas is to:

* Allow users to visualise dynamic thematic maps of India on green, blue and brown environment issues
* Meet the educational and research goals of all users
* Provide easy and convenient access to geo-spatial data
* Provide information in the Pressure – State – Impact – Response (PSIR) framework
* Regularly provide the public, government, non-government organisations and decision makers with accurate, timely and accessible information.
